How Our Black Water Extraction (Category 3) Service Actually Works
With Category 3 Black Water Extraction, every minute counts. Our team springs into action, using specialized equipment to contain the spread of water and prevent further damage. We’ll measure moisture levels, set up drying equipment, and monitor the situation until your property is safe and dry.
Step 1: Containment and Assessment
We’ll arrive with a team of technicians, equipped with moisture meters and containment equipment. Within minutes, we’ll assess the situation, identify the source of the leak, and begin containing the water to pr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, we’ll use our powerful p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This is a critical step, as the longer you wait, the more damage you’ll face.
Step 3: Disinfection and Drying
After the water’s removed, we’ll disinfect the area to prevent the growth of bacteria and mold. Our drying equipment will then be set up to dry your property thoroughly, ensuring every surface is completely dry within 3-5 days.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and clean. We’ll remove any remaining debris, and you’ll be free to return to your home.

Black Water Extraction (Category 3) Cost in Midvale, ID
The cost of Category 3 Black Water Extraction can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Midvale, ID. These estimates are based on real-world scenarios and are subject to change based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Containment and Assessment |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, complexity of containment |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water extracted, equipment needed |
| Disinfection and Drying |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of cleanup |
| Emergency Services (after hours) | $500 – $2,000 | Time of day, urgency of situation |
| Debris Removal | $1,000 – $3,000 | Amount of debris, complexity of removal |
